Rococo St Kilda's atmosphere is both seductive and vibrant, bustling and intimate. The place where Rococo’s signature antipasti boards and simple Italian flavours first came to be, it continues to attract diners from all over Melbourne some 10 years later. Set amongst some of Melbourne’s most loved sites – The Palais, The National Theatre and St Kilda beach to name a few – our expanded restaurant space is bigger than ever, yet remains cosy and flexible, with various spaces available for functions and plenty of nooks for private dining or close conversations.
Join us for a meal of many courses; a hearty breakfast to start the day, a jovial work lunch, a family get together or just a glass of wine to celebrate the end of a day. Oh and our Wood Fire Pizzas are a must. Enjoy the authenticity, quality and warm hospitality of modern Italy right here in Melbourne.
Al fresco outside seating also available.

Additional information

  • Price
    $40 and under
  • Cuisines
    Italian, Pizzeria, Café
  • Hours of Operation
    Mon–Thu 12:00 pm–10:00 pm Fri 12:00 pm–11:00 pm Sat 11:30 am–11:00 pm Sun 11:30 am–10:00 pm
  • Dress code
    Casual Dress
  • Parking details
    Street Parking
  • Payment Options
    AMEX, Mastercard, Visa
  • Executive Chef
    Chris Fulham, Leigh McHarry
